For centuries, the blacksmith has been a master of utilitarian sculpture. Today, the craft of the artist-blacksmith remains entrenched in that respected tradition; to create lasting beauty from iron. When it gets red-hot, iron takes on a malleable quality that, with the right tools and experience, can be formed into a limitless variety of shapes and forms. The artist’s creativity flows easily into the red-hot iron and once it cools, you can rest assure that the piece will remain intact for generations.

Paul Reimer began his career as an artist-blacksmith at the age of 15 and over the past 30 years he has been commissioned to produce large-scale residential, commercial and public art projects across North America. His sculptures and artistic furniture are featured in galleries in The US and Canada and his work is collected by art enthusiasts in many countries around the world.

He takes inspiration from a variety of sources; architecture and design, culture, history, relationships and nature. Paul takes pride in being “hands-on” in every phase of the creative process. He designs, creates and installs every piece of art he is commissioned to produce.

For thousands of years and across innumerable cultures, bird nests have been a symbol of home, protection and prosperity. They speak to building a strong foundation for family and community, to abundance and to the potential for the future.

The nest embodies ingenuity and hard work – the foundations necessary to build home and community. Nestled safely inside is a golden egg, a symbol of the prosperity and potential made possible by strong, vital communities.

This light-hearted sculpture conveys a powerful message; that amidst the challenges and complexity of life, there is always the promise of growth, beauty, and opportunity.

I create all my sculptures using centuries-old blacksmithing techniques and I very much enjoy using the skills I’ve honed over 35 years to produce an image of something as fragile and delicate as a bird nest and egg in a form that is durable enough to last for generations.
